Wednesday’s dinner and Thursday’s lunch is sausages with a cauliflower and white bean purée and peas – all made in the Thermomix.  The new draft recipe is below.

Draft Recipe

Sausages with Cauliflower & White Bean Purée and Peas

Ingredients

500g water

1/2 head cauliflower, cut into florets (~500g)

400g can cannellini beans, rinsed and drained

800g thick sausages

1 large onion

20g olive oil

1 tbsp Thermomix vegetable stock concentrate

20g water

50g reduced fat milk

Salt & pepper, to season

2 cups frozen peas, rinsed with boiling water

Instructions

1. Put cauliflower and beans in to the Varoma bowl and put sausages in the tray

2. Add 500g of water into the Thermomix bowl, close the lid, assemble the Varoma and place on top of the Thermomix

3. Cook for 20 minutes/Varoma/Speed 1

4. Remove the Varoma and empty the water from the Thermomix bowl

5. Put onion into the bowl and chop for 4 seconds/Speed 5

6. Add oil into the Thermomix bowl and sauté with the measuring cup (MC) off for 2 minutes/100C/Speed 1

7. Add cauliflower, beans, stock, water, milk, salt and pepper into the bowl and close the lid

8. Put peas into the Varoma bowl and tray with sausages back in the Varoma, assemble and put on the Thermomix

9. Cook for 5-10 minutes/Varoma/Speed 1 until the sausages are cooked through

10. Remove Varoma, put the MC on and purée for 30 seconds – going slowly from Speed 1 to Speed 9
